Output 394653ac41f8d6214bfa5f658bb0c4260792a455c3b668b90c74eda524547322:1

value
636151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ed8e83811835dc826eb6002db764389de18196d OP_EQUAL
address
3HdXLthT5xLbnQFhPdbkQJCozeymKtMJBP
transaction
394653ac41f8d6214bfa5f658bb0c4260792a455c3b668b90c74eda524547322
spent
true